RATIONALE: Drugs used in chemotherapy use different ways to stop tumor cells from dividing so they stop growing or die. Combining more than one drug may kill more cancer cells.
PURPOSE: Phase II trial to study the effectiveness of irinotecan and docetaxel in treating patients who have metastatic or locally recurrent head and neck cancer.

OBJECTIVES:
- Determine the response rate in patients with metastatic or locally recurrent head and neck cancer treated with irinotecan and docetaxel.
- Determine the progression-free and overall survival of patients treated with this regimen.
- Determine the toxic effects of this regimen in these patients.
- Correlate angiogenesis markers and cyclooxygenase-2 expression with response and survival in patients treated with this regimen.
- Correlate UGT1A1 genotype with the toxic effects of this regimen in these patients.
OUTLINE: This is a multicenter study. Patients are stratified according to prior chemotherapy (no prior chemotherapy for locally recurrent or metastatic disease or more than 6 months since prior chemotherapy as primary therapy vs 1 prior chemotherapy regimen for locally recurrent or metastatic disease or less than 6 months since prior chemotherapy as primary therapy).
Patients receive docetaxel IV over 60 minutes followed by irinotecan IV over 30 minutes on days 1 and 8. Courses repeat every 21 days in the absence of disease progression or unacceptable toxicity.
Patients are followed every 3 months.
